     We are looking for a Spotfire analytic platform that can perform entity extraction.  Entity extraction is the process of locating phrases in an input document and classifying these phrases into a set of categories. This information can then be used to better understand the content of the document. Entities can be concrete objects, such as people or companies, or more abstract objects, such as percentages. For example search application could use entity extraction to provide the capability of finding all documents in a given corpus that contain a company name, even if the user does not know the exact name of the company he is searching for. Entity extraction can be used to examine a corpus and see what names are most frequently mentioned (that is, most popular), which is something that cannot be done with simple keyword searches. Entity extraction can be used to markup documents with useful links. As an example, an application could use entity extraction to find all the places in their documents, and link the text of each place to a map showing the absolute location.  It can also provide a summary report of the extraction.
